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Most Property and Financial Settlement matters can be resolved through negotiation and agreement without requiring court intervention. However, if parties cannot reach consensus or disputes become more contested, court or tribunal involvement may become necessary. The need for court action depends on various factors including the complexity of assets involved, whether both parties cooperate, and how disagreements progress throughout the process. In Tea Tree Gully, SA, attempting to resolve matters outside court is often the preferred initial approach, though having legal representation from the outset can strengthen your position in negotiations. Based on your location in Tea Tree Gully, SA, one nearby court location is: Elizabeth Magistrates Court 15 Frobisher Road, Elizabeth This location is provided for general context only. Property and Financial Settlement matters are generally handled in the Family Court or Federal Circuit Court, depending on the complexity and jurisdiction.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Property and Financial Settlement lawyers cost in Tea Tree Gully, SA?
Property and Financial Settlement lawyers in Tea Tree Gully, SA typically charge between $350 and $700 per hour. These hourly rates fluctuate based on the practitioner's experience level, firm size, and specific expertise in property matters. Total costs depend significantly on the complexity and time investment required for your particular situation. Straightforward matters such as reviewing property settlement agreements or providing initial advice about asset division generally require fewer billable hours, keeping overall expenses toward the lower end. More involved cases involving business valuations, superannuation splitting, or contested property disputes demand extensive preparation, negotiations, and potentially court appearances, resulting in substantially higher total fees.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Property and Financial Settlement lawyer in Tea Tree Gully, SA?
During Property and Financial Settlement matters in Tea Tree Gully, SA, it can help to have photo identification, recent financial statements from banks and superannuation funds, property valuations, and mortgage documentation available. You may also be asked to provide tax returns from recent years, details of assets and debts, plus any existing court orders or separation agreements if applicable.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ation. Some Australia Post offices offer services like certified copies, photo ID, or printing.
